Three Scenarios of Patience

  1. Fulfilling Duties
    • Includes religious and worldly duties, rooted in the remembrance of God.
    • Duties enhance one's ability to practice religion.
  2. Avoiding Prohibited Actions
    • Avoiding what is offensive to God requires patience and fortitude.
  3. Dealing with Trials and Tribulations
    • Recognizing the nature of this world as a place of testing.
    • Understanding that ultimate comfort is in the next life.
    • Patience helps in accepting the world's imperfections.

Obligations of Patience

  • Patience in fulfilling obligations, avoiding despair, and maintaining faith during trials.
  • Realizing nothing exists without divine wisdom.

Quranic Verses on Patience

  • Surah Al-Baqarah 155: Tests of fear, hunger, loss, and patience bring glad tidings.
  • Surah Az-Zumar 10, Surah Ash-Shura 43: Patience leads to immeasurable rewards.
